Land grading services involve the process of shaping and leveling the ground on a property to create a stable and even surface. This typically includes removing excess soil, filling in low spots, and contouring the land to ensure proper drainage and stability. Proper grading is essential for preparing a site for construction, landscaping, or other outdoor projects, helping to establish a solid foundation and prevent issues related to uneven terrain.
One of the primary issues land grading addresses is water drainage. Poorly graded land can lead to water pooling, erosion, or water runoff that affects structures and landscaping. By ensuring the land slopes away from buildings and other critical areas, grading services help protect properties from water-related damage, reduce the risk of flooding, and promote healthier soil conditions. Additionally, proper grading can prevent uneven settling of structures and reduce the likelihood of future maintenance problems caused by shifting ground.
Properties that typically utilize land grading services include residential homes, commercial properties, farms, and recreational areas. Residential properties often require grading before constructing driveways, patios, or lawns to ensure proper water flow and stability. Commercial sites benefit from grading to prepare parking lots, building foundations, and landscaping features. Agricultural properties may need grading to improve irrigation and prevent soil erosion, while parks and sports fields also rely on grading to maintain safe and level playing surfaces.

The overview below groups typical Land Grading proj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Dahlonega, GA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Land Grading - Typically costs between $1,000 and $3,000 for small to medium projects. For example, grading a residential yard in Dahlonega, GA, might fall within this range depending on size and complexity.
Driveway and Large Area Grading - Prices usually range from $3,000 to $8,000 or more. The cost depends on the size of the driveway and the terrain, with larger projects requiring more extensive work.
Site Preparation and Excavation - Costs can vary from $2,000 to $10,000 based on the scope of clearing and leveling. Heavier excavation work for building sites tends to be at the higher end of this range.
Additional Services and Customization - Extra features like drainage solutions or retaining walls may add $1,000 to $5,000. The overall cost depends on specific site needs and project complexity.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
